The climate of La Trinité
La Trinité, located in
Martinique, primarily experiences an Af type tropical rainforest environment according to the Köppen climate classification. Rainy, humid conditions are prevalent year-round, accompanied by a consistently warm tropical climate. As per the data provided, ocean temperatures maintain a steady warmth throughout the year, while daylight hours slightly fluctuate.
In this tropical climate, sea temperatures remain relatively constant encompassing a narrow range of 26.9°C (80.4°F) to 29.4°C (84.9°F). This consistent warmth in the ocean temperatures contributes to the overall high humidity experienced in this region. Meanwhile, daylight averages in Martinique range from 11.3 hours to 13 hours. Sunlight duration is longest during the summer months, corresponding to an increase in daylight hours.
Furthermore, distinct weather patterns aren't typically observed in La Trinité due to its tropical rainforest climate, few anomalies occur. However, it is noteworthy that the sea temperatures peak to 29.4°C (84.9°F) during
September, while the daylight hours maximise to 13 during
June.

Spring Weather in La Trinité
During the spring from
March to
May,
La Trinité witnesses a subtle rise in both sea temperatures and daylight hours. Ocean temperatures range from 27°C (80.6°F) to 28.2°C (82.8°F), while daylight hours extend from 12.1 to 12.8. This period ensures a surge in warmth, matched by an extended duration of sunlight.
Summer Weather in La Trinité
The tropical summer in
La Trinité, which runs from
June to
August, experiences the area's longest days, with daylight averaging from 13 hours in June to 12.6 hours by August's end. Simultaneously, sea temperatures gradually rise during these months, reaching from 28.4°C (83.1°F) to 28.9°C (84°F).
Autumn Weather in La Trinité
Autumn is marked by a slight decrease in daylight hours, from 12.2 hours in
September to 11.5 hours in
November. Concurrently, sea temperatures peak in September at 29.4°C (84.9°F), before gradually reducing to 28.3°C (82.9°F) in November, maintaining the general warmth.
Winter Weather in La Trinité
Winter in
La Trinité sees the shortest days, with
December and
January recording an average of 11.3 to 11.4 hours of daylight. Yet, the sea remains warm, with temperatures ranging from 27.3°C (81.1°F) to 27.6°C (81.7°F), ensuring year-round tropical warmth against the slight reduction in daylight hours.
